If you are interested in Bankrupt in Blood, I would recommend taking a look at Costly Plunder from Ixalan instead: you sacrifice 1 creature for 2 cards, instead of 2 for 3, but you can also sacrifice artifacts, and it's an Instant.

I'm still not sold on the switch from black cards causing life loss to them doing damage, especially when you're harmingyourself. Life loss makes it feel more like a price being paid; a bit of your life essence is the cost required for such magics.
Damaging yourself is 100% spot-on for Blade Juggler, though.
